Maurus (Rome, 500 à 512-Gallië, 584) was benedictijner monnik. Hij was een zoon van de Romeinse edele Eustachius en werd als jongen ter opvoeding gegeven in het klooster van Sint-Benedictus. Hij zou de opvolger van Benedictus zijn als abt van de Abdij van Subiaco, wanneer Benedictus wegtrok om de abdij van Montecassino te stichten. Een van de legenden omtrent Maurus heeft betrekking op zijn redding van Placidus, waarbij hij over het water zou hebben gelopen. Lees meer op Wikipedia
